A new study has been released that shows the impact of human-induced climate change on global sea levels, focusing on the change from 1900 to 2005. 

It found that, worldwide, one in a hundred-year flooding event had a median increase to the 1 in 8-year event average over this time. Even more concerningly, the study found that the increase was not geographically balanced, and Wellington coastal floods have increased to roughly a twice-per-year occurrence.

Relevantly, last week Wellington faced large swells up to 9 metres, resulting in a state of emergency and mandatory evacuation orders at numerous bays in the area.

To discuss the results of the study and how best to respond to the findings, host Thomas talked to Victoria University Professor of Climate Science & Physical Geography, James Renwick.
